Team Fortress 2 filter_tf_condition is a point entity available in Team Fortress 2 Team Fortress 2.

Entity description

A filter that only allows players affected by a certain condition.

Keyvalues

BaseFilter:

Filter mode (Negated) <boolean>
Inverts the filter, making the specified criteria fail and all others pass.
condition ([todo internal name (i)]) <integer>
The condition to check against

Inputs

BaseFilter:

TestActivator <variantRedirectInput/variant>
Tests the entity that called the input (the !activator) against the filter, and fires either the OnPass or OnFail output. (the parameter it takes is unused)
Icon-Bug.pngBug:Calling this input will cause the server to crash if the !activator entity no longer exists. Do not use this input to test any entities which may be asynchronously deleted, such as players or projectiles, or in an i/o chain which might be initiated by entity deletion, such as the OnEndTouch output of a trigger.

Outputs

BaseFilter:

OnPass
OnFail
!activator = activator of TestActivator input
!caller = this entity
One of these will fire when TestActivator input is sent, depending on if the activator is allowed by the filter or not.
